Overview

1 mCi quantity of [3H(G)]-Hypoxanthine Monohydrochloride is available for your research. Application of [3H]Hypoxanthine can be found in: activity of artemisinin against Plasmodium falciparum in parasitology, uptake and release by equilibrative nucleoside transporter 2 (ENT2) of microvascular endothelial cells in pharmacology, quantitative assessment of DNA replication to monitor microgametogenesis in parasitology, etc.

Hypoxanthine monohydrochloride [3H(G)]- Aqueous solution Steri-packaged, not for human use Shipped ambient. 10-30Ci(370GBq-1.11TBq)/mmol
